1. Colors That Fade Like Old Photos
Sun and chemicals are brutal on pool liners. A once-bright liner can turn to a splotchy ghost of itself, especially where sunlight hits the waterline. It isn’t just ugly—that fading meant the vinyl was thinning and ready to crack. If your liner’s pattern is barely there or looks washed out, it’s crying for help. A new one brings back the sparkle and strength.
2. Tears That Break Your Heart
A rip in the liner is like a punch to the gut. Cracks come from age, harsh sun, or wonky chemicals—winter’s freeze doesn’t help. Patches are a short fix. If you see tears, a full replacement is the only way to keep your pool safe.
3. Wrinkles That Won’t Smooth Out
A liner should fit like a second skin, but sometimes it can start to sag, with creases pooling in corners like unwanted guests. It looked sloppy, and leaves loved those folds—yuck. Over time, vinyl stretches, slipping loose or wrinkling up. Those flaps trip up cleaners and invite punctures. If your liner’s baggy, it’s time for a snug new fit.
4. Water Slipping Away Quietly
Ever top off your pool too often, with no clue why? Pinholes could be leaking water–they’re sneaky, hiding in creases or deep down. If water’s vanishing, a new liner stops the drain.
5. Too Old to Keep Up
Most liners last 8–12 years with care. Old liners flake out when you least expect. New ones are tougher, with better UV shields and fresher looks. If yours is pushing a decade, swap it before it quits on you.
6. Stains and Smells That Stick Around
Some stains just won’t budge. Those stains and smells aren’t just gross; they signal the vinyl’s breaking down. If cleaning fails, a new liner’s the answer.
